Who funds North Dakota Community Foundation?
North Dakota Community Foundation is funded by 21 grantmakers, led by Otto Bremer Trust ($1.9M), The Bush Foundation ($1.4M), National Philanthropic Trust ($675K). In total, IRS Form 990 filings record $5.0M in grants to North Dakota Community Foundation between 2019–2025.

| 2022 | The Bush Foundation | THE NORTH DAKOTA NATIVE TOURISM ALLIANCE, A SPONSORED ORGANIZATION OF NORTH DAKOTA COMMUNITY FOUNDATION, WILL DEVELOP AND TEST A NEW MODEL OF TOURISM THAT CREATES TOUR PACKAGES SPECIFIC TO AND CREATED BY NATION NATIONS IN NORTH DAKOTA. THIS MODEL COMBATS A HISTORY OF COLONIZING NARRATIVES AND PRACTICES WITHIN TOURISM WHERE NON-NATIVE ENTITIES PRIMARILY DOMINATE THE NARRATIVES AND OWN THE SITES MOST FREQUENTLY ENCOUNTERED WITHIN TOURISM EXPERIENCES. THIS FIVE-YEAR PROJECT WILL INCLUDE PRODUCT DEVELOPMENT, IMPLEMENTATION AND CAPACITY BUILDING. THE ULTIMATE AIM OF THIS WORK IS TO EDUCATE VISITORS ABOUT NATIVE AMERICAN HERITAGE AND TRIBAL NATIONHOOD AND TO CREATE ECONOMIC OPPORTUNITIES WITHIN NATIVE COMMUNITIES. | $684,000 |
